Our Daily Routine
Our timetable is largely flexible and can be adapted where necessary to meet the needs and interests of the children.
8.50am – 9.00am – Arrival
Our children are welcomed by a staff member and are supported by parents to put their personal belongs on their pegs. Entering SKIPS main room, the children are greeted by another member of staff who encourages them to find their name and place it on our registration tree. Children say goodbye to their parents/carers and start playing and exploring.
9.20am – 9.35/40am – Group Time
Children go off in little groups with staff members. Staff support the children’s learning and development with a main activity, engaging and interacting with children to make learning fun.
9.35/40am – 11.30am – Playing and Exploring and Snack time
Depending on how the day is going snack will either be as a whole group or on a rolling basis with their key person or buddy.
11.30am – 11.40/45am – Singing or Story
Child spilt off into two groups and either have singing, story, or both whilst waiting for their parents/carers to collect them or washing hands for lunch time. This is really fun and interactive time.
11.45am till 12.30pm – Lunch Club
Children and staff sit together to eat their healthy packed lunches. Children who attend either morning or afternoon sessions can stay for lunch club. We use the main room for most children and one of the Nursery rooms for lunch club for the children attending Nursery in the afternoon.
As the children arrive from Nursery ready for the afternoon session at SKIPS they are asked to find their name and place it on the registration tree. Once the children have finished their lunch, staff will take the children outside until the afternoon session starts.
